Output 72c32016f338b597d7ea9f131b276ecc82f04b0c041da0c20d72d3a673541da3:1

value
32451000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48f0b169f32ab88cda9eaf5cfc3cbb18506e7622 OP_EQUAL
address
38Lguzx88wLU9r66sPkQA9ZnMHjfanDAoh
transaction
72c32016f338b597d7ea9f131b276ecc82f04b0c041da0c20d72d3a673541da3
confirmations
435936
spent
true